A very fine Sheraton mahogany two drawer work table, attributed to Thomas Seymour Boston, Massachusetts, circa 1815.

This high quality table features richly grain mahogany veneers and an pleasing mellow historic surface. The rectangular top has outset corners above two long drawers with original lion mask pulls.. The sides of the case are fitted with candleslides at each side. The outset legs have reeded tops which begin at the corners of the case and extend into a tapered shart resting on brass castors. Height 28 3/8”; 22”; Depth 15 ½”
